.cm-store-position{padding:4rem 0}.cm-store-position *,.cm-store-position :after,.cm-store-position :before{box-sizing:inherit}.cm-store-position .cm-store-position-width{box-sizing:border-box;margin:0 auto}.cm-store-position h2{font-size:2rem}.map-list-store-wrapper.list-right .store-locations .store-locations-title h3{font-size:1.5rem;margin:0}.map-category{text-align:right}.map-category select{-webkit-appearance:none;border:1px solid #e5eef7;box-sizing:border-box;display:inline-block;font-size:1rem;font-weight:500;margin-bottom:1rem;max-width:100%;min-height:39px;outline:0;padding:.7rem 1em;width:300px!important}.map-custom-select{position:relative}.map-description{max-width:400px;width:400px}.map-description .map-photo{height:200px;overflow:hidden}.map-description .map-photo img{height:100%!important;object-fit:cover;width:100%}.map-description h3{font-size:1.5em;padding:10px 15px}.mt-5{margin-top:2rem}.map-description h4{font-weight:300}.map-description h3.map-heading{font-size:1.3rem;margin:0 0 1rem;padding:0}.map-description .loc-title{margin:0}.map-description .loc-desc p{margin:4px 0}.map-description .loc-website{margin-left:13px}.loc-website a{background:#dfdfdf;color:#1c242c;display:inline-block;font-weight:600;margin-bottom:10px;padding:10px 15px;text-transform:uppercase}.loc-website a:before{background:#cd1015;content:"";display:inline-block;height:15px;left:0;margin-right:10px;-webkit-mask-image:url(https://www.leadstreet.be/hubfs/assets/images/Icon%20ionic-ios-globe.svg);mask-image:url(https://www.leadstreet.be/hubfs/assets/images/Icon%20ionic-ios-globe.svg);-webkit-mask-size:cover;mask-size:cover;position:relative;top:1px;width:15px}.map-list-store-wrapper .store-locations .single-store-location{display:flex;flex-direction:column;justify-content:space-between;padding:10px}.map-list-store-wrapper .store-locations .single-store-location .store-location-flex{display:flex}.map-list-store-wrapper .store-locations .single-store-location:not(.active){display:none}.map-list-store-wrapper .store-locations .single-store-location .single-store-marker{margin-top:0}.map-list-store-wrapper .store-locations .single-store-location .single-store-marker img{width:28px}.map-list-store-wrapper .store-locations .single-store-location .single-store-details{padding-left:10px;width:calc(100% - 30px)}.map-list-store-wrapper .store-locations .single-store-location .single-store-details h3{font-size:1.3em;margin-bottom:8px;margin-top:0}.map-list-store-wrapper .store-locations .single-store-location .single-store-details h3 a{color:#0d1012;text-decoration:none}.map-list-store-wrapper .store-locations .single-store-location .single-store-details p{margin:5px 0 10px}.single-store-location .loc-desc{padding-bottom:2em}.single-store-location .loc-website a{background:#f2f5f8 url(https://www.leadstreet.be/hubfs/assets/images/Icon%20ionic-ios-globe.svg) no-repeat 15px 50%;color:#1c242c;display:inline-block;font-weight:600;margin-bottom:10px;padding:10px 15px;text-transform:uppercase}.single-store-location .strong-one{font-weight:700}.single-store-location .single-store-cats{border-top:1px solid #e5eef7;padding:10px 10px 0 2.2em}.map-list-store-wrapper.list-bottom .store-locations,.map-list-store-wrapper.list-top .store-locations{display:flex;display:grid;flex-wrap:wrap;grid-template-columns:repeat(3,minmax(320px,1fr));grid-gap:10px}.map-list-store-wrapper.list-top .store-locations{padding-bottom:3rem}.map-list-store-wrapper.list-bottom .store-locations .single-store-location,.map-list-store-wrapper.list-top .store-locations .single-store-location{background:#f9f9f9;border:1px solid #e5eef7;margin-left:0;padding:15px;width:100%}.map-list-store-wrapper.list-left,.map-list-store-wrapper.list-right{display:flex;flex-wrap:wrap}.map-list-store-wrapper.list-left .store-locations,.map-list-store-wrapper.list-right .store-locations{border:1px solid #f7f7f7;font-size:14px;height:500px;overflow-y:scroll;width:400px}.map-list-store-wrapper.list-left .store-locations .single-store-location,.map-list-store-wrapper.list-right .store-locations .single-store-location{background:#f7f7f7;border-bottom:1px solid #fff;padding:15px!important}.map-list-store-wrapper.list-left .store-locations .store-locations-title,.map-list-store-wrapper.list-right .store-locations .store-locations-title{background:#f7f7f7;padding-left:15px;padding-right:15px}.map-list-store-wrapper.list-left .map-main-wrapper,.map-list-store-wrapper.list-left .store-locations,.map-list-store-wrapper.list-right .map-main-wrapper,.map-list-store-wrapper.list-right .store-locations{width:100%}.gm-style .gm-style-iw-c{border-radius:3px!important;box-shadow:0 3px 24px 0 rgba(28,36,44,.6);padding:0!important}.gm-style .gm-style-iw-c button.gm-ui-hover-effect{right:-4px!important;top:-4px!important}.gm-style .gm-style-iw-c button.gm-ui-hover-effect:before{background:#fff;border-radius:100%;content:"";height:18px;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:18px}.gm-style .gm-style-iw-c button.gm-ui-hover-effect img{filter:brightness(0) invert(1)}.gm-style .gm-style-iw-d{overflow:auto!important;overflow-y:scroll!important}div.single-store-location.active_map .icon_default,div.single-store-location:not(.active_map) .icon_active{display:none}.gm-style-iw-d .loc-address{padding:0 15px 10px}.gm-style-iw-d .loc-desc{padding:10px 15px}div[data-ext-index]:not(.active){display:none!important}.store-locations-title{grid-column:1/2;padding-bottom:1rem;padding-top:1rem}@media (min-width:768px){.store-locations-title{grid-column:1/3}.map-list-store-wrapper.list-left .map-main-wrapper,.map-list-store-wrapper.list-right .map-main-wrapper{width:calc(100% - 300px)}.map-list-store-wrapper.list-left .store-locations,.map-list-store-wrapper.list-right .store-locations{width:300px}}@media(min-width:1025px){.store-locations-title{grid-column:1/4}.map-list-store-wrapper.list-left .map-main-wrapper,.map-list-store-wrapper.list-right .map-main-wrapper{width:calc(100% - 400px)}.map-list-store-wrapper.list-left .store-locations,.map-list-store-wrapper.list-right .store-locations{width:400px}.map-list-store-wrapper.list-right .map-category{text-align:left;width:200px}}@media(max-width:1100px){.map-list-store-wrapper.list-bottom .store-locations,.map-list-store-wrapper.list-top .store-locations{grid-template-columns:repeat(2,minmax(320px,1fr))}}@media(max-width:767px){.map-list-store-wrapper.list-bottom .store-locations,.map-list-store-wrapper.list-top .store-locations{grid-template-columns:repeat(1,minmax(200px,1fr))}.map-description{width:100%}.map-description .map-photo{height:150px}.map-main-wrapper #map{height:350px!important}.map-list-store-wrapper .store-locations .single-store-location{display:block;padding:10px!important}}.loc-jurisdictions{gap:.5rem;p{font-size:1rem;font-weight:700;line-height:1.1;margin:0}img{height:3rem;max-width:110px;object-fit:cover;width:auto}}.jurisdictions{display:flex;flex-direction:column;gap:.7rem}.gm-style-iw{border:2px solid #0091a3}.gm-style-iw-d{padding:0 1rem .5rem}.gm-ui-hover-effect>span{height:23px!important;width:23px!important}.gm-ui-hover-effect{height:auto!important;width:auto!important}.map-custom-select{display:none!important}.last-blurb p{font-size:1rem;font-weight:500;line-height:1.7;margin-top:1rem}.store-locations{display:none!important}.loc-jurisdictions{align-items:flex-start;align-items:center;display:flex;flex-direction:row}.description{font-size:1rem;font-weight:700;line-height:1.1;margin:0}